Output 31da682ce84e055b1434c367b6619baee2729d93b3bc7ab5bc0ed74b43e6d854:3

value
670446
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f8b714aa9bc7b86d401c6557ac3f25759b81d44 OP_EQUALVERIFY OP_CHECKSIG
address
1KvPvM7gJy7HBvRFu3ofbqSXeL4HvKGF7N
transaction
31da682ce84e055b1434c367b6619baee2729d93b3bc7ab5bc0ed74b43e6d854
spent
true